Child creativity
Description
By exercising and developing creativity, a child develops intellectually and emotionally; this experience leads to development of motor skills, practise with various instruments, criteria for determining position in life, and the benefit of group interaction. Such creativity is the potential for the development of society in general and may be developed through technical (machine) and artistic (drawing, literary, etc) improvisation.
